Client profile

TorqueLine Service runs a multi-bay independent auto shop handling oil changes, tire swaps, brake work, and seasonal changeovers. The front desk is two service advisors who also write repair orders, walk customers through estimates, and hand back keys. Almost every booking starts as a phone call: drivers call from the road, from a parking lot, or right after they hear a new noise, and if nobody picks up they simply dial the next shop on the list.

The challenge

The service desk juggled walk-ins and phone calls, and after-hours callers couldn't book an oil change or a tyre swap.

Empty bays on slow mornings were lost revenue nobody had time to chase.

The service counter was the bottleneck. An advisor standing with a customer at the desk, explaining what the technician found on the lift, could not also answer the phone. Calls rolled to voicemail during the morning drop-off rush and again in the late afternoon pickup window, exactly when demand was highest. The voicemails that did get left were returned hours later, by which point the caller had already booked somewhere else.

Anyone who called after closing had no way to book at all. Tire season made it worse: a cold snap or the first snowfall produced a spike of evening calls asking about changeover slots, and every one of those calls hit a recorded message. The shop was turning away routine, high-volume work that fills bays efficiently.

The result was a lopsided week. Quiet mornings left lifts empty while the afternoon backed up, and nobody at the counter had the time or the call list to go back and fill the gaps. An empty bay on a slow morning is capacity that never comes back, and the team had no mechanism to recover it.

The solution

A MyChatBot voice agent now answers the service line around the clock, reads live bay availability, and books oil changes, tire changeovers, brake inspections, and diagnostics straight into the shop calendar while the advisors stay on the floor.

  1. Put the agent on the line MyChatBot Calls SDK took inbound calls on the main service number, picking up on the first ring during the drop-off rush and after hours instead of routing to voicemail.
  2. Teach it the shop The Knowledge Base holds Business Domain docs covering service types, typical bay time per job, tire storage rules, seasonal changeover policy, warranty terms, and directions, with Agentic Search pulling the right answer mid-call.
  3. Wire it to the calendar Google Calendar integration lets the agent check real free slots per bay, offer the caller two or three concrete times, hold the appointment, and confirm it before the call ends.
  4. Write the record in CRM create_crm_lead and add_crm_client_contact capture the driver, phone, vehicle make, model, year, mileage, and requested job, tagged source AI-, with lead_chat_link attaching the call recording to the lead.
  5. Escalate the complex jobs Hand-off Control routes anything past routine scheduling, a warning light, an accident estimate, a warranty dispute, to a service advisor, with Flight Control pinging the team in Telegram so nobody waits.
  6. Chase the loose ends Follow-ups reach back to callers who asked about a job but did not commit, and Lead Processing labels and statuses keep no-shows and open estimates visible instead of buried in a notepad.
Knowledge Base: The agent's Knowledge Base carries the service menu with typical bay time per job, seasonal tire changeover and storage policy, brake and diagnostic intake questions, parts lead times for common models, warranty and estimate terms, shop hours, and drop-off and key-box instructions.
